Your glutes are the largest, most powerful muscle group in your body — driving nearly every athletic movement and protecting your lower back. Building them isn't just about aesthetics; strong glutes improve posture, performance and injury resistance.

The most effective glute builders

  • Hip thrusts — the single best glute-focused lift
  • Barbell or goblet squats
  • Romanian deadlifts
  • Bulgarian split squats
  • Walking lunges
  • Glute bridges
  • Cable kickbacks
  • Step-ups

How to train glutes for growth

Train glutes 2-3 times per week with a mix of heavy compound lifts and higher-rep isolation work. Aim for 10-16 weekly sets, focus on a full range of motion, and squeeze hard at the top of each rep to maximise activation.

Progressive overload is key

Like any muscle, glutes grow when you gradually add resistance or reps. Track your hip thrust and squat numbers and push to add a little each week. Pair training with adequate protein and you'll see steady change.

The takeaway

Prioritise hip thrusts and squats, train twice a week, and progressively overload. Strong glutes will transform your strength, posture and shape.
